zoukankan      html  css  js  c++  java
  • QTP版“古城钟楼”使用QTP完成微博定时发送脚本代码 @以轩

    因为比较简单,话不多说,直接上代码

    PS:在QTP9.2及IE7环境下测试通过

     1 '*************************************************
     2 'Written by  @以轩-之名
     3 'Date :  2013年1月11日
     4 '仅供娱乐和学习使用
     5 'QQ:85645204
     6 '
     7 '**************************************************
     8 On Error Resume Next 
     9 
    10 Dim HourNow,MinNow   '用以保存当前小时值及分钟值 
    11 
    12 While True
    13 
    14     '获取小时和分钟值
    15     HourNow = Hour(Time)
    16     MinNow = Minute(Time)
    17 
    18     '如果分钟值为0;则为整点,进行报时
    19     If  MinNow = 0 Then
    20         Select Case HourNow
    21 
    22             Case 23
    23                 DangDang "【子时】"
    24 
    25             Case 1
    26                 DangDang "【丑时】咚~"
    27             
    28             Case 3
    29                 DangDang "【寅时】咚~咚~咚~"
    30             
    31             Case 5
    32                 DangDang "【卯时】咚~咚~咚~咚~咚~"
    33             
    34             Case 7
    35                 DangDang "【辰时】咚~咚~咚~咚~咚~咚~咚~"
    36             
    37             Case 9
    38                 DangDang "【巳时】咚~咚~咚~咚~咚~咚~咚~咚~咚~"
    39             
    40             Case 11
    41                 DangDang "【午时】咚~咚~咚~咚~咚~咚~咚~咚~咚~咚~咚~"
    42             
    43             Case 13
    44                 DangDang "【未时】咚~"
    45             
    46             Case 15
    47                 DangDang "【申时】咚~咚~咚~"
    48             
    49             Case 17
    50                 DangDang "【酉时】咚~咚~咚~咚~咚~"
    51             
    52             Case 19
    53                 DangDang "【戌时】咚~咚~咚~咚~ 咚~咚~咚~"
    54             
    55             Case 21
    56                 DangDang "【亥时】咚~咚~咚~咚~咚~咚~咚~咚~咚~"
    57 
    58             Case else 
    59                 wait 0
    60         
    61         End Select
    62         
    63         
    64     End If
    65     '等待60秒,执行下一循环
    66     wait 60 
    67     
    68 Wend
    69 
    70 Sub DangDang (txt)
    71 
    72    With  Browser("micClass:=Browser").Page("micClass:=Page")
    73 
    74         .WebEdit("class:=input_detail","name:=WebEdit").set txt
    75         wait 1
    76         .Link("innerhtml:=发布","class:=send_btn").click
    77 
    78    End with
    79     
    80 End Sub

        相比于原版的3万行代码,这个加上注释和空行总计80行。缺点是得开着QTP和网页啦。

        仅供娱乐使用,转载注明出处。

        

  • 相关阅读:
    py爬取英文文档学习单词
    windows 下使clion支持c++11操作记录
    angular在ie8下的一个bug
    连连看小游戏前端实现
    如何禁止页面文字被选中
    分享一个BUG
    描点链接元素的优化提升用户体验
    模拟淘宝滚动显示问题解决入口
    简易图片轮播效果
    支付战争
  • 原文地址:https://www.cnblogs.com/zhm450/p/2856318.html
Copyright © 2011-2022 走看看